Ramiza Raja was fuming on BBC Radio during the 4th ODI between Pakistan & England.
Speaking about the Pakistani batsmen not kicking on despite (theoretically) having 9 wickets in hand and the score crossing 200, Ramiz blasted the likes of Babar for playing for his century. He went on to say this is a common mindset amongst Pakistani, Indian and Bangladeshi batsmen.
A telling stat was in the last 6 ODIs which have been completed by Pakistan a batsman has scored 100 but Pakistan has lost all 6.
Is this sort of selfish batting really hurting our chances?
Is the solution simply getting players to play for the team, rather than themselves, or are the players simply not able to bat at a higher SR?
